Ingredients
Katsu Sauce
Baby Lettuce
Ground Turkey
Sesame Dressing
Chicken Stock Concentrate
Mayonnaise
Panko Breadcrumbs
Scallions
Potato Buns
Sliced Almonds
Cooking Oil
Black Pepper
Salt
How to make it
1
Step 1
Wash and dry produce. Trim and thinly slice scallions on a diagonal, separating whites from greens.Trim and discard root end from lettuce; separate leaves. Reserve two whole leaves (four whole leaves for 4 servings) for assembling burgers in Step 5. Chop remaining leaves into bite-size pieces.
2
Step 2
In a medium bowl, combine pork*, scallion whites, stock concentrate, panko, ½ tsp salt (1 tsp for 4 servings), and pepper.Form into two patties (four patties for 4), each slightly wider than a burger bun.Heat a drizzle of oil in a large pan over medium-high heat. Add patties and cook until browned and cooked through, 3-5 minutes per side.In the last minute of cooking, top patties with half the katsu sauce (you’ll use the rest in the next step); cover pan and cook until sauce is warmed through and patties are coated, 40-60 seconds more.
3
Step 3
Meanwhile, halve and toast buns until golden brown.In a small bowl, whisk together mayonnaise and remaining katsu sauce.
4
Step 4
In a large bowl, toss chopped lettuce with sesame dressing. Season with salt and pepper if desired.
5
Step 5
Spread cut sides of buns with katsu mayo. Fill buns with patties and reserved whole lettuce leaves.
6
Step 6
Divide burgers and salad between plates. Sprinkle salad with almonds and scallion greens. Serve.
